For example, identical discontinued dinner …In 1907, Jean Haviland left Haviland and Company, moved to Germany, changed his name to Johann (John), and built a ceramics factory in Waldershof. The firm produced porcelain ceramics focused on the middle-market consumer and the hotel industry. It is unclear if production was halted or slowed during World War I.

The majority of figural RB pieces were sold from 1890 - 1920s, so chances are your piece is about 100 years old. The "1794" shown on the mark is when the works was founded (not the age of your piece). Marks on the bottom will help date the piece. To identify the source of a Bavarian china pattern and authenticate the piece, turn the china over, and check the bottom for the maker’s mark. The maker’s mark is unique to the man...1907 - 1990. The history of the Johann Haviland Company dates back to 1855, when David Haviland opened the Haviland and Co. porcelain factory in Limoges, France.
